Researchers at several institutions have come up with evidence that simply showing gratitude may be among the most powerful -- and underused -- forces in our lives. It can strengthen relationships, and make us happier and more satisfied with our lives. There is compelling evidence that expressing gratitude regularly can change a person's life. A scientist said that giving gratitude is an emotional reaction and a way of looking at the world. Giving thanks is a sustainable approach to life that can be freely chosen for oneself. It is choosing to focus on blessings rather than burdens, gifts rather than curses, and people report that it transforms their lives. It also strengthens our relationships. The scientist said, not only do we get the internal, personal benefits but also the external relational elements that are less likely to happen if the gratitude stays silent. Giving thanks is good for the giver, as well as for the receiver. This has been documented in friendships, associations, romantic partners and spouses. One study showed that the mere expression of thanks more than doubled the likelihood that helpers would provide assistance again. Bottom line everybody will be happy.
